Inner Reef is a reef-rich Atauro site with a shallow top and a longer slope that gives the dive shape without losing its easy, reef-first character. It sits in one of Timor-Leste's most protected marine areas, where clear water, coral gardens, and dense fish life make it attractive for relaxed snorkeling, freediving, and easy reef diving. The site feels approachable at the top and more expansive as you follow the slope, so mixed-experience groups can split their comfort zone without splitting the day.

Depth range, seasonality, and planning context.
Reported Depth
3m - 35m
Depth Note
Public descriptions place the shallow top around 3-5 m and the reef slope into a sandy channel around 11-35 m with soft coral patches.
Best Season
April through November, when seas are usually calmest
Typical Conditions
Warm tropical reef water, excellent visibility, and a shallow top that rolls into a deeper slope with soft corals.

Scuba Diving
The shallow top makes this a friendly reef dive, while the deeper slope gives scuba divers a longer profile if they want it.
Freediving
The shallow reef top is excellent freedive terrain on calm days, and the site has enough contour to keep breath-hold exploration interesting.
Snorkeling
This is one of the site's strengths: a shallow, clear-water reef top that is easy to enjoy without dropping deep.
